CJ Carr is just getting started at Notre Dame and he’s already receiving significant recognition for his play.
The redshirt freshman quarterback has shown flashes of being a superstar at the position and now his performance this season has earned him a spot among the country’s top young standouts.
Carr was recently named one of the five finalists for the Shaun Alexander Freshman of the Year award, given annually to the top freshman in college football.
The Saline native is joined by Ohio State quarterback Julian Sayin, North Texas quarterback Drew Mestemaker, Miami receiever Malachi Toney and Alabama cornerback Dijon Lee Jr.
Carr has been lights out for the Fighting Irish as he has completed 195 passes for 2,741 yards and 24 touchdowns to six interceptions.
